TENAA Certified Vivo V1950A Could be Vivo NEX 3 5G with SD865

In the recent weeks, a new Vivo phone that has a model number of V1950A was spotted on the Chinese certification platforms such as CMIIT and 3C. These listings could confirm that the Vivo V1950A is a 5G smartphone and it may ship with a 44W fast charger. Today, the smartphone was spotted at TENAA with some of its initial specs.

The TENAA listing has no images of the phone yet. As revealed in the screenshots, the Vivo V1950A 5G smartphone measures 167.44 x 76.14 x 9.4mm and is equipped with a 6.89-inch screen. These specs are exactly same as that of the Vivo NEX 3 5G phone that had gone official in September last year. The NEX 3 5G had debuted as Vivo’s first phone with 5G support.

The Vivo NEX 3 5G has a 4,500mAh battery with 44W fast charging support. The newly spotted Vivo V1950A could be featuring a slightly smaller battery as its minimum capacity is mentioned as 4,250mAh. The NEX 3 5G came with a 44W charger. The same could be expected from the Vivo V1950A phone. The model number of NEX 3 5G for China is V1924A/T.

The Vivo V1950A with 5G support seems to be a flagship phone. The Exynos 980 powered Vivo X30 and Vivo X30 Pro phones that had debuted in December 2018 were the first Vivo phones to arrive with support for dual-mode 5G. The Vivo V1950A 5G with support for SA and NSA 5G networks could be the company’s first 5G flagship smartphone.  Hence, it could be the Snapdragon 865 mobile platform powered edition of the Vivo NEX 3 5G.
